Cryptocurrencies have captured global attention not only for their potential to reshape finance but also for their dramatic price swings. Over the past several years, few asset classes have exhibited as much volatility as digital currencies like Bitcoin, Ethereum, and Dogecoin. While long-term trends often dominate headlines, it’s the day-to-day volatility that poses a critical challenge to their real-world utility—especially as a medium of exchange.
Bitcoin, for example, has traded above $20,000 recently but soared past $50,000 in 2021 before dipping near $30,000 within the same year. Ethereum and Dogecoin have followed similarly erratic paths. Yet beyond these headline-grabbing shifts, crypto assets frequently swing by several percentage points in a single day—far exceeding the daily movements of traditional financial instruments.
Understanding Short-Term Cryptocurrency Volatility
The day-to-day price fluctuations in cryptocurrencies are consistently more extreme than those seen in stocks, fiat currencies, or precious metals. This isn’t just an occasional anomaly—it’s a structural feature across time periods and major digital assets.
Between 2018 and 2022, Bitcoin’s average daily price change—measured as the absolute percentage shift from the previous day—was 2.87%. Compare this to major fiat currencies: the Euro (0.34%), British Pound (0.43%), and Japanese Yen (0.35%). Even stable assets like gold showed far less movement.
Other cryptocurrencies fared worse:
- Ethereum: 3.76% average daily change
- Ripple (XRP): 4.04%
- Dogecoin: 4.55%
These figures highlight a key issue: such intense short-term volatility undermines one of the core functions of money—serving as a reliable medium of exchange.

Why Daily Volatility Matters for Real-World Use
For any currency to succeed, it must be trusted not just as a store of value or speculative asset, but as something people can use confidently in daily transactions. High day-to-day volatility introduces significant exchange rate risk, even over 24 hours.
Imagine a merchant accepting Bitcoin for goods today, only to see its value drop 5% by tomorrow. The seller bears the loss unless they immediately convert to a stable currency—adding complexity, cost, and friction. Similarly, buyers may hesitate if they expect the currency to appreciate sharply overnight.
This volatility explains why cryptocurrency adoption as a payment method remains limited. Outside niche environments—such as certain online marketplaces—widespread usage has stalled. A 2018 study noted that Bitcoin’s short-term swings were already increasing transaction costs and reducing trade volume on dark web platforms, where anonymity once drove demand.
In essence, when prices swing wildly from one day to the next, neither party in a transaction wants to bear the risk—making crypto less practical than traditional payment systems.
Structural Causes Behind Crypto’s Price Swings
Several factors contribute to this exceptional volatility:
1. Absence of Central Market Stabilizers
Traditional financial systems benefit from central banks, market makers, and large institutional reserves that absorb shocks and provide liquidity. In contrast, most cryptocurrencies operate without centralized intermediaries by design—removing stabilizing forces that dampen short-term swings.
2. Market Liquidity and Speculative Behavior
Crypto markets are still relatively shallow compared to established equity or forex markets. Large trades can disproportionately impact prices, especially during low-volume periods. Additionally, speculative trading dominates much of the activity, amplifying emotional responses to news and macro trends.
3. 24/7 Trading Without Circuit Breakers
Unlike stock exchanges, which close on weekends and have mechanisms like circuit breakers to pause trading during extreme moves, crypto markets never sleep. This constant availability allows volatility to compound rapidly without natural cooling-off periods.
Emerging Solutions to Reduce Volatility
While challenges remain, innovation within the crypto ecosystem is actively addressing these issues.
The Lightning Network
Bitcoin’s Lightning Network enables faster, cheaper transactions off the main blockchain. By facilitating microtransactions and reducing confirmation times, it improves usability and reduces exposure to price swings during settlement delays.
Stablecoins: Bridging Stability and Decentralization
Stablecoins—digital tokens pegged to fiat currencies like the U.S. dollar—are designed specifically to eliminate day-to-day volatility. They allow users to stay within the crypto ecosystem while avoiding wild price swings.
Popular examples include USDT (Tether) and USDC (USD Coin), which maintain a 1:1 value with the dollar through collateral reserves or algorithmic mechanisms. These assets enable traders to “park” funds during turbulent times and simplify cross-border payments.
However, stablecoins aren’t without risks. Their reliance on centralized custodians or complex algorithms introduces new vulnerabilities—from regulatory scrutiny to potential de-pegging events, as seen with TerraUSD in 2022.

Balancing Innovation with Practicality
While solutions like the Lightning Network and stablecoins show promise, they also raise philosophical questions within the crypto community. Both approaches reintroduce elements of centralization or dependence on traditional financial systems—precisely what early crypto pioneers sought to escape.
Bitcoin maximalists often argue that no improvement is needed—that Bitcoin itself is the ultimate solution. But clinging to ideological purity risks stifling progress. For cryptocurrencies to achieve mass adoption, they must evolve beyond speculative instruments into functional tools for everyday commerce.
Entrepreneurial experimentation must continue. Whether through hybrid models, decentralized stablecoins, or improved layer-2 protocols, the path forward lies in balancing decentralization with usability.
Regulatory Caution: Avoiding Premature Constraints
Regulators play a crucial role—but overreach could freeze innovation at a critical stage. Rules that lock in current technologies or ban promising developments may prevent better solutions from emerging organically through market testing.
Instead, policymakers should focus on transparency, consumer protection, and anti-fraud measures without prescribing technical standards. A light-touch approach allows space for discovery while minimizing systemic risk.

Frequently Asked Questions
Q: What causes day-to-day crypto volatility?
A: A mix of low liquidity, speculative trading, absence of market makers, 24/7 trading cycles, and lack of central stabilization mechanisms contributes to sharp daily price swings.
Q: How does crypto volatility compare to traditional assets?
A: Cryptocurrencies typically experience daily changes several times higher than fiat currencies, stocks, or gold. For instance, Bitcoin’s average daily move (2.87%) dwarfs that of the Euro (0.34%).
Q: Can stablecoins solve volatility issues?
A: Yes—stablecoins are designed to maintain a steady value by being pegged to fiat or other assets. However, they introduce new risks related to reserves, regulation, and centralization.
Q: Is high volatility good or bad for crypto?
A: It attracts short-term traders but hinders long-term adoption as a payment method. For broader use, reduced volatility is essential.
Q: Will crypto volatility decrease over time?
A: As markets mature, liquidity improves, and institutional participation grows, volatility may decline—but structural differences will likely keep it higher than traditional assets.
Q: How can users protect themselves from daily price swings?
A: Using stablecoins for savings or transactions, employing hedging strategies, or leveraging fast settlement networks like Lightning can help minimize exposure.
